What is 50/61 Divided By 2/5

Answer: 5061÷25\frac{50}{61}\div\frac{2}{5} = 12561\frac{125}{61}

Solving 5061÷25\frac{50}{61}\div\frac{2}{5}

  • Rewrite the Division as Multiplication by the Reciprocal:

5061÷25=5061×52\frac{50}{61} \div \frac{2}{5} = \frac{50}{61} \times \frac{5}{2}

  • Multiply the Numerators: 50×5=25050 \times 5 = 250
  • Multiply the Denominators: 61×2=12261 \times 2 = 122
  • Form the New Fraction: 5061×25=250122\frac{50}{61} \times \frac{2}{5} = \frac{250}{122}

Let's Simplify 250122\frac{250}{122}

  • Find the Greatest Common Divisor (GCD) of 250250 and 122122. The GCD of 250250 and 122122 is 22.
  • Divide both the numerator and the denominator by the GCD:250÷2122÷2=12561\frac{250 \div 2}{122 \div 2} = \frac{125}{61}

Answer 5061÷25=12561\frac{50}{61}\div\frac{2}{5} = \frac{125}{61}
